Stalin demands all-party meet, slams CM Vijay's 'unilateral' diplomacy in Cauvery row

in5points
  1. DMK president M K Stalin demanded an all-party meeting on the Cauvery river issue.

  2. Stalin criticized Tamil Nadu Chief Minister C Joseph Vijay for 'unilateral' diplomacy.

  3. Stalin said Vijay's visit to Karnataka ended in isolation and rejection.

  4. Stalin cited past experience that a legal battle is the only way forward.

  5. Stalin noted Karnataka Chief Minister D K Shivakumar called an all-party meeting on August 2.
